Bill Gates’ and Paul Allen’s friendship repaired?

When Microsoft co-founder Paul Allen published his book “Idea Man” last year, he surprised many people by tearing into his longtime friend and business partner Bill Gates.
In a new epilogue published for the paperback version of this book, which comes out this week, Allen writes that after a yearlong rift, the two men have repaired their friendship, according to GeekWire.
